WHISTLER’S ANGEL

John Maxim

William Morrow Hardcover 

3/01

ISBN 0-380-97545-9

 

Adam Whistler has a dark past and part of it is catching up with him. To protect himself he has stolen a ledger from his old boss and is using it as an insurance policy. The ledger contains illegal transactions that stem from the U.S. drug search and seizure laws. Many men got rich from these schemes and Whistler now has a record of their names. One of the men that he used to work for makes a stupid and dangerous mistake, he goes after Whistler’s girlfriend and her mother. This action brings Whistler’s very powerful father into the game. A man that no one trifles with.

I was very disappointed in this book. I thought that the hero, who is thirty-four, is at first too much under the thumb of his father and then under the thumb of his girlfriend. I waited for him to come into his own but he didn’t. I don’t know if it was intentional on the part of the author but some of the “thugs” have a Donald E. Westlake cartoon character quality. With that said, I do recommend Mr. Maxim’s BANNERMAN series as well as my favorite book of his, THE SHADOW BOX.

 

Reviewed by Pat Kersten

(from Pat's Mysterious Corner)

Rating:  FAIR
